2533-19 Illustrator
Draws and paints pictures that assist in presentation and
meaning, and explain narrative, dialogue and ideas.
Skill Level:
The entry requirement for this occupation for migration purposes is a bachelor degree or higher qualification.
This occupation requires high levels of creative talent or
personal commitment and interest as well as
formal qualifications and experience.
Tasks Include:
- examines assignment brief and related material, and prepares
layouts and sketches of proposed illustrations
- determines style, technique and medium to produce the
desired effects and conform with reproduction requirements
- conceives and renders illustrations and details from models,
sketches or imagination
- uses pens, ink, charcoal, crayons, paint and other materials to
create drawings and illustrations
- discusses and amends illustrations with clients and production
team at various stages of completion
- uses computers to develop and enhance illustrations
- illustrates children’s books, scientific work, technical manuals,
reference books and other publications
- may specialise in product packaging, corporate, medical or
architectural illustration
- may prepare series of drawings to illustrate an animated
sequence in a television or film production
Specialisations:
Animator
Cartoonist
